They will be facing off against Robert Griffin III and the Washington Redskins.
The Chargers don’t do well against quarterbacks that are mobile and Griffin is one of the guys that can kill us by breaking free outside of the pocket. He will present the Chargers with a challenge on defense. The Chargers offense should be able to move the football against the Redskins offense though. Philip Rivers will have to remain sharp and the offense will have to control the football game.
